WebFour-corner fusion with scaphoidectomy is indicated for Stage III SLAC wrist. Surgical treatment of SLAC wrist is stage dependent. Stage I disease (scaphoid-radial styloid arthritis) is treated with AIN/PIN neurectomy. This procedure can also be done in addition to other bony procedures for Stages II-III disease.
